Method
Coffee Base
- 1
Brew coffee
Brew a strong hot coffee using fresh grounds. Aim for about 6 fl oz of finished coffee. If using instant or concentrated coffee, dissolve to yield 6 fl oz of hot coffee. Keep coffee hot (near boiling) until assembly.
Spirits & Liqueur
- 2
Warm the serving glass by rinsing it with a little hot water and discarding the water. Add 1.5 fl oz vodka and 1 fl oz Kahlúa to the warmed heatproof glass.
Sweetener & Cream
- 3
Add 0.5 tsp simple syrup (or sugar) to the spirits in the glass. Stir briefly to dissolve. Pour the 6 fl oz of hot brewed coffee into the glass over the spirits, stirring gently to combine.
- 4
Top with cream
Lightly whip 1 tablespoon heavy cream so it is slightly thickened but still pourable. Gently float the cream on top of the coffee by pouring it over the back of a spoon held just above the surface. Do not fully mix—the cream should form a distinct layer.
Garnish (optional)
- 5
Dust the cream lightly with 1/4 tsp freshly ground espresso or coffee grounds for aroma and visual contrast. Float 3 whole coffee beans on the cream if desired.
